Thomas Dolby & Kathleen Beller

If you didn't watch Dynasty or see the video for "She Blinded Me with Science" throughout the day on MTV, you might not be familiar with the ultimate 80s couple Thomas Dolby and Kathleen Beller - still married thirty-one years later.
